I played in the club competition Sunday and off the tee I never hit anything longer than my 5 wood (2009 Cleveland Launcher) which I can hit about 200-205 yards with good contact. I never hit in trouble all day. I shot my 4th best round ever ( 13 over) came 2nd out of 57 players and got cut back to 18.
i know my course is short but with the current clubs going so far do us high handicappers need to struggle with drivers and 3 woods?

I usually only hit my driver 4 times on my home course and the rest of the time I usually hit my 18 degree utility iron. I hit it about 230 with a cut an as much as 270 with a draw. On most courses I dont need anything more than that. When I really need to cover some distance I can hit my driver anywhere from 285 to the occasional 300+ yarder but the big dog stays in the bag for the most part unless there is little to no trouble in its yardage range.
 
I like my 3 wood, I can rely on the distance much better than my driver. The driver will still get the ball further but if I'm shooting for 205 to 220 because of trouble somewhere in the fairway the 3 wood comes out because I can crush it and not land in hazards.
